On Saturday night, Jake Allen had to leave the game in the second period when Dylan Larkin hit him head on. All fans remember the images of Jake Allen losing his helmet. He also lost his mind on this sequence, he left for a few moments following this collision to start the concussion protocol.

That said, this morning I replayed the sequence a few times to name the main culprit on this catch. If I put myself in his shoes for a moment, I sincerely believe that my journey would have been the same. How can the Wings captain sincerely avoid Allen in a split second?
With Petry's push while Larkin was cutting to the net, the collision could not be avoided, let's face it. Even if it had been his own goalie, as Marc-André Perreault pointed out, I remain convinced that it would have been just as impossible to avoid.
Following the meeting, Dominique Ducharme did not want to go into depth on this issue, but between the lines, we can perhaps understand that Larkin did not do everything to avoid it.
We're talking here, but a fox that just comes out of the woods, right in front of you while you're driving your car at 100 kilometers per hour, it's impossible not to hit him with 0.1 seconds to spare.
Whether you're a fan or not, in this case, let's be logical and analyze the replay with neutral eyes.
